PBT/PC blend, injection molding grade, non-reinforced, impact modified, excellent toughness at low temperatures, very good paintability
General Information
Additive
  • Impact Modifier
Features
  • Impact Modified
  • Low Temperature Toughness
  • Paintable
Processing Method
  • Injection Molding
